In CASE applications (Coatings, Adhesives, Sealants, Elastomers), thermo plastic polyurethanes can be processed more efficiently by add- ing the modifier Modulast PUR. The use of polyols and isocyanates can be reduced, while the physical proper- ties are maintained and often even improved. This not only significantly reduces overall raw material costs. The entire production process also becomes more efficient, benefiting from lower temperatures during pro- cessing and resulting in shorter cycle times. Products for plastics coloring LANXESS’ Polymer Additives and Inorganic Pigments business units offer the plastics industry high-per- formance, sustainable colorants for direct coloration. The business units will present their product ranges for the energy-efficient production of col- ored plastic goods, which eliminate the need for subsequent coating and thus avoid reworking. This includes both universal products and special- ties for particular requirements. In electromobility, for example, the color orange is a mandatory safety feature for high-voltage plastic com- ponents. This is where Macrolex Orange HT comes into play. Its com- prehensive properties meet the high safety and performance requirements for electric cars. These include excel- lent heat stability, improved sublima- tion resistance as well as high migra- tion stability, color strength and light fastness. Efficient flame retardants for polymers With brominated and phosphorus- based solutions, LANXESS’ Polymer Additives business unit offers one of the most comprehensive ranges of organic flame retardants in the world. The polymeric and reactive flame retardants reduce the release of additives from polymers, thus con- tributing to environmental and health protection without compromising fire safety. Due to their high efficiency, brominated flame retardants are widely used in the construction and electronics industries. In addition to effective fire protection, phosphorus- based flame retardants offer other advantages such as good process- ability and high elasticity in PU and PVC systems. Additives for rubber processing A wide range of additives for the rubber processing industry will be presented by the Rhein Chemie business unit. These include predis- persed chemicals, processing pro- moters and vulcanization and filler activators. In the spirit of advancing sustainability, the focus will be on not only rubber production but also the manufacture of high-quality, long-lasting rubber products de- signed for a whole range of appli- cations such as tires, hoses, seals, profiles, and drive belts. The lifetime is an important indicator for the sustainable performance of rubber products. Additives such as Perkalink and Vulcuren from LANXESS allow tire manufacturers to develop and produce mixtures for tires designed to deliver ultra-high performance over their entire service life.
